Germany-based equipment manufacturer Baader has made a number of improvements to its salmon processing line, including the introduction of a high speed filleting machine, improved trimming options and a new control system.

Baader’s new 581 filleting machine has been designed in a completely new manner with respect to hygiene, performance and fillet quality, said the company. And a stable run of the fish through the machine guarantees higher throughput, it added.

The machine’s settings can be changed during operation and can be stored in a recipe archive for easier handling and quick change over to alternative products.

According to Baader, the 581 leaves almost no head bones, no membrane leftovers or bone residues in the belly area, a clean anal area, and no chips in the tail section. The white membrane can be removed or left on.

Following the 581 filleting machine, the 518 automatic transfer unit manages the product flow in the line and into the subsequent Baader 988 automatic trimming machine.

The 518 unit is controlled by the 581 filleting machine. It ensures that all fillets from the 581 have the right orientation to get into the subsequent 988 machine.

The 518 will reject double placings etc. and correct the distance between the fillets for improved efficiency. It has an improved hygienic design and the manufacturer claims it is easier to maintain.

Baader’s 988 automatic trimmer also communicates with the 581 filleter. It now works at a higher speed over the full size range of the fillets according to the higher speed of the new 581.

The 581 with its best fillet performance has opened new trimming options for the 988. Besides standard options like different belly cut features, colour grading, melanin spot detection, cutting recipes, statistics etc, and the surface trim can now change its position from the belly to the neck area and an integrated tail cutter performs the best tail cut for the skinning machine.

The detection of colour, melanin etc. can be transferred to the following grader for sorting function.

Baader’s 560 Final Control Unit is designed for online trimming. It is also possible that fillets which were not trimmed at the 988 – perhaps because of “mal-position” - can be deflected and trimmed offline and fed back into the process.

This final control system is modular and can be put together according to customers’ layouts.

Baader’s new Manufacturing Execution System (MES) serves as the intermediary between a business system such as ERP and a manufacturer’s plant floor equipment, helping to manage production scheduling and sequencing, creating an audit trail for track and trace and delivering work instructions to shop floor workers etc.

Baader offers a control system that can collect data from every step of the process, which the company said can be used to optimise yield while ensuring traceability throughout the process.

“MES makes it possible to optimise each step of the downstream process flow while enabling quick and efficient detection and elimination of upstream processing defects. We call it intelligent production control,” Baader said.

In summary, Baader’s new integrated salmon processing line consists of:

  • The heading machine 434, which performs a yield-saving U-cut. It measures each fish and its self-adjusting cutting tools allow for maximum yield.
  • The new high-speed filleting machine 581 for high fillet quality at high speed with much less trimming required.
  • The new automatic transfer unit 518 for managing the product flow into the further process.
  • The new 988 fully automatic fillet trimming machine with higher speed and new trimming features adapted to the Baader 581 filleting machine.
  • Baader 560 Final Control Unit in a modular design for online and optional offline trimming.
  • A weighing and grading system for yield calculation, batching and managing the further product flow regarding size, quality, colour, melanin etc.
  • Baader’s new production software for visualising and optimising customers’ production with full traceability.
